COQUITLAM, B.C.  – Castle Silver Resources’ shareholders have approved (99.97% in favour) a name change to Canada Cobalt Works Inc. The change is subject to TSE Venture exchange approval. [caption id="attachment_1003722096" align="alignright" width="300"] Canada Cobalt president and CEO Frank Basa underground in the old Castle silver mine where he worked in the early 1980s after graduating with a degree in metallurgical engineering. CASTLE SILVER RESOURCES[/caption] The new name reflects the company’s interest in the past producing Castle mine and infrastructure near Cobalt, Ont. The new moniker also reflects the company’s proprietary Re-2OX process for cobalt recovery.
